Subject: Handover — LockerPass release duties

Taking over LockerPass releases from this cycle. Plugin authors: the laundry-locker access flow now verifies signed plugin manifests at install, so unsigned builds will be rejected from v3.2 onward. Build as usual, sign before upload, and keep your manifest schema at v2. Docs in the portal cover the CLI flags. For compatibility testing against our staging verifier, the current deploy key is below.

signing key of bagap-yawep = bky13_TbfT6ZMUoGJo2

**Vendor note: Inkmill markdown pipeline**

Rendering for Parchway docs is outsourced to Inkmill under an annual contract, renewing each March. They handle sanitization and PDF export; we own the upload queue. SLA: 4-hour response on rendering failures. Escalate only after two failed retries. Their support desk is reachable at the address below.

billing contact of hahaf-baguf = zorael.tammir.jorius@sivrelhq.internal

Onboarding: Spare Hardware Storage

Spare laptops, monitors, cables, and docking stations are kept in Room 4.18 at the Harkwell Building, opposite the print hub. If your kit fails in your first weeks, ask your team lead before taking anything — every item must be logged on the sheet inside the door. The room is climate controlled, so keep the door shut. Access is restricted to staff with induction complete. Enter using the code below.

badge for kageg-fajog: bdg-FNNRG-32288

**Joint Venture Proposal — Kestrel Mills Partnership** *(Restricted: managers only)*

This page summarises the proposed joint venture between our Fieldworks division and Kestrel Mills to co-develop the Ashgrove processing site. Ownership split, governance structure, and capital schedule are under board review. Updates will be posted after each negotiation round. The current strategic position is noted below.

board note of bawep-tajef: Queniusek Systems plans to raise the Quenvan list price by 53.1 percent in March. The pricing group signed off on a budget of $176.4 million for Project Drueth. The renewal with Casionix Partners closes at $142.5 million a year, 8.3 percent below the last contract. Project Fraax slips by six weeks because of the tooling delay.